REPAIR METHOD FOR HEAVY DUTY CORROSION-PROOF STEEL MATERIAL AND HEAVY DUTY CORROSION-PROOF STEEL MATERIAL
To provide a repair method for heavy duty corrosion-proof steel material allowing the heavy duty corrosion-proof steel material which has deteriorated or may deteriorate in corrosion-proof durability to be efficiently repaired to effectively extend corrosion-proof durability of the heavy duty corrosion-proof steel material.SOLUTION: A repair method for heavy duty corrosion-proof steel material comprises: a first step of exposing basis steel material of the heavy duty corrosion-proof steel material; a second step of cleaning a surface of the exposed basis steel material; a third step of forming a corrosion inhibitor layer on a surface of the cleaned basis steel material; a fourth step of covering a surface of the corrosion inhibitor layer with a woven fabric or nonwoven fabric resin sheet; and a fifth step of forming a waterproof resin layer on a surface of the resin sheet.SELECTED DRAWING: Figure 1
